Output 170453be6e29105598074db58d32d16617f5d182ae2e2887f44ed7456ccd61e8:22

value
31934386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b79b50ff8e884ea7ba7fe0ce3b296d481e58a5e OP_EQUAL
address
MGEqXFq2FAfKMBbtuK9aAXprn6SsYhcJiY
transaction
170453be6e29105598074db58d32d16617f5d182ae2e2887f44ed7456ccd61e8
spent
true